Strong's Exhausive Concised Dictionary - תֹּם
תֹּם
H8537
Transliteration: tôm
Pronunciation: tome
Definition: full
תֹּם (tôm | tome)
[Heb] תֹּם OSHL: w.az.ab TWOT: 2522a GK: H9448" class="dictionary-topic-link">H9448 Greek:ἀλήθεια , ἄμωμος , ἁπλότης , ἀπό , δῆλος , καθαρός , μετοικεσία , ὅσιος , ὁσιότης
Derivation: from תָּמַם;
Strong's: completeness; figuratively, prosperity; usually (morally) innocence
KJV: full, integrity, perfect(-ion), simplicity, upright(-ly, -ness), at a venture. See תֻּמִּים.
